Another huge show is set for AEW Dynamite.

Last week, Scorpio Sky pulled off a shocking upset by pinning the AEW World Champion. Not surprisingly, Chris Jericho wasn’t thrilled with the result, and tonight, the Inner Circle leader will address his loss. Also scheduled is a pair of first-ever singles matches, as Jon Moxley will fight Darby Allin and Nick Jackson will take on Fenix.

In another first-ever match-up, Private Party look to get revenge for the Young Bucks after the vile attack from Santana & Ortiz. Will Isiah Kassidy and Marq Quen be the first team to takedown Proud N’ Powerful?

In a women’s match, Britt Baker and Hikaru Shida will meet inside the squared circle. Both talents are looking to be the next #1 contender for the AEW Women’s Championship, so can Baker maintain her #1 ranking? Or will Shida knock her down a few ranks?

All this and more is confirmed for tonight’s AEW Dynamite! Check out the confirmed match-card below:

Jon Moxley vs. Darby Allin

Private Party vs. Santana & Ortiz

12-Man Dynamite Dozen Battle Royal

Nick Jackson vs. Fenix

Private Party (Isiah Kassidy and Marq Quen) vs. Proud N’ Powerful (Santana and Ortiz)

Britt Baker vs. Hikaru Shida
